Cartridge Design and Performance

Born from the pursuit of ballistic superiority, the .338 Ultra Magnum (or .338 RUM) emerged as a bold step forward. It wasn’t just an incremental improvement; it was a significant leap. This cartridge is a powerhouse, designed to launch heavy, high-ballistic-coefficient bullets with remarkable velocity. The result is a trajectory that defies distance, making it ideal for hunting large game at extreme ranges and excelling in long-range target shooting competitions.

Key Features

The .338 Ultra Mag’s exceptional capabilities derive from its design. It boasts a substantial case capacity, allowing for the efficient burning of a large volume of powder. This, in turn, drives the bullet with incredible speed, reducing bullet drop and wind drift, crucial factors at extended ranges. Shooters can select from a variety of bullet diameters, commonly including those ranging from two hundred grain to three hundred grain bullets, allowing for customization to meet specific needs. An important factor in maximizing the .338 Ultra Mag’s potential lies in understanding the proper twist rate for your rifle, depending on the bullet weight, to ensure optimal stabilization and accuracy.

Advantages and Considerations

The advantages of the .338 Ultra Mag are numerous. Its high ballistic coefficient ensures minimal loss of velocity and energy over long distances. The flat trajectory simplifies holdover calculations, making hitting your target easier. Its high retained energy also makes it a formidable cartridge for taking down large game at considerable distances.

However, the .338 Ultra Mag is not without its considerations. Recoil, while manageable with proper techniques and rifle configuration, is substantial. Barrel life, due to the high pressures and velocities involved, may be shorter compared to other cartridges. The cost of components, especially premium bullets and specialized powders, also needs to be factored into your budget. Understanding these aspects will help you make informed decisions and enjoy the full potential of this exceptional cartridge.

Essential Equipment

To embark on this journey safely, you will need some essential equipment. A reloading press provides the foundation for the entire process, allowing you to resize cases, seat primers, and seat bullets. Reloading dies are crucial as well, for resizing the case and seating bullets. A precision scale is paramount for accurate powder measurement. Case preparation equipment, such as a case trimmer, deburring tool, and chamfering tool, are vital for ensuring consistent case dimensions, and ultimately, safety and accuracy.

The Value of Precision

The meticulous measurement is key to success. The powder charge should be carefully measured, to the tenth of a grain, or even more precisely. Bullet seating depth, often overlooked, greatly influences pressure and accuracy. Any deviation from published data, whether by a few tenths of a grain or a small change in seating depth can dramatically impact the results and lead to dangerous pressure levels.

Reliable Data Sources

Always obtain your load data from reliable sources, such as manufacturer manuals like those from Hodgdon, Nosler, and Sierra. Familiarize yourself with the limitations and cautions associated with each type of powder, primer, and bullet. Never substitute components without consulting reliable load data.

Dangerous Practices

Avoid all dangerous practices. Do not overload cartridges. Watch for signs of excessive pressure and always start with the minimum recommended powder charge and increase it gradually. Never double charge a case with powder. Double charging creates a catastrophic pressure increase. Never mix powders, which can lead to unpredictable and dangerous pressure spikes. Follow published data meticulously, and never deviate without a thorough understanding of the potential consequences.

Selecting the Right Components

Brass Selection

The success of your handloading efforts rests heavily on the quality of components you choose. Careful selection and diligent preparation of these components are essential.

Brass Selection: The .338 Ultra Mag is often loaded to very high pressures, therefore, case quality is vital. Select brass from reputable brands. Preparing the brass, including trimming the case to the specified length, removing burrs from the case mouth and primer pocket, and chamfering the mouth, are equally important. This step is crucial to ensuring consistent bullet seating and neck tension.

Primer Selection

Primers play a significant role in initiating the combustion process. For the .338 Ultra Mag, Large Rifle Magnum primers are generally recommended to ensure reliable ignition of the large powder charges used. The primer’s burn rate must align with the selected powder for optimum performance.

Powder Selection

Powder Selection: The right powder is at the heart of the .338 Ultra Mag’s performance. Powders with slower burn rates are typically favored. Powders like Reloader twenty-five, H one hundred, Retumbo, and others specifically designed for magnum cartridges are often chosen for their ability to deliver high velocities with heavy bullets. Consult load data from reputable manufacturers and consider the temperature sensitivity of the powder, as this can significantly affect your load’s performance under varying weather conditions. Compare different powders to evaluate their performance characteristics and select those that meet your needs.

Bullet Selection

Bullet Selection: The .338 Ultra Mag has a wide selection of bullet options, offering many performance levels. Select a brand known for accuracy and terminal performance. Bullet weights vary greatly, from those weighing two hundred grains up to three hundred grains. Consider the ballistic coefficient (BC) of the bullet. A high BC is your key to long-range performance. Bullet construction is crucial for both hunting and target shooting. Determine the application, and select bullets appropriate to the situation. Bullets designed for hunting generally exhibit controlled expansion, while target bullets prioritize accuracy.

Advanced Techniques and Considerations for Optimization

Optimal Cartridge Overall Length

Maximizing the performance of the .338 Ultra Mag involves several advanced techniques.

Optimal Cartridge Overall Length (COL): COL is the distance from the base of the case to the tip of the bullet. It’s essential to find the optimal COL for your specific rifle and load, which usually involves carefully measuring the distance from the bolt face to the lands of your rifle barrel. Adjusting the bullet seating depth can greatly impact accuracy.

Chronographing

Chronographing: This is vital for measuring the velocity of your handloads. Using a chronograph enables you to verify your load’s performance against published data. It also helps to identify any inconsistencies in your handloads.

Pressure Testing

Pressure Testing: While full pressure testing requires specialized equipment, understanding pressure signs is critical. Be aware of what your rifle is telling you. Watch for signs of excessive pressure.

Altitude and Temperature

Altitude and Temperature: These conditions significantly affect the ballistics and the performance of your load. Higher altitudes and extreme temperatures can change the burn rate of powders, altering velocities and pressures. Take these variables into account when developing or adjusting your loads.

Barrel Break-in

Barrel Break-in: Proper barrel break-in procedures are often recommended for new barrels, especially those chambered for cartridges like the .338 Ultra Mag.

Troubleshooting and Problem-Solving

Common Issues

You may encounter a few issues during your handloading.

Failure to Fire: Check for a firmly seated primer, and try another primer from the same batch.

Inconsistent Velocities: This can be a product of many factors. Verify that the powder charge is consistent, that the bullets are seated evenly, and that the brass has proper neck tension.

Poor Accuracy: Begin by ensuring that all of your components are of high quality, and your rifle is in good working order. Check the bullet seating depth and try different powders and bullet combinations.

Pressure Issues

Pressure Issues: If you see flattened primers, ejector marks, or difficult bolt lift, stop. Immediately discontinue that load, and consult a reliable source of information.
